Arizona SB1819 amends the statewide aviation plan to include public vertiports and electric aircraft charging stations.

Arizona SB1819 mandates the Arizona Department of Transportation to develop a statewide plan for public vertiports and electric aircraft charging stations, and to include advanced air mobility infrastructure needs. The plan will be created through consultations with various stakeholders, including political subdivisions, commercial air carriers, and federal agencies. Local jurisdictions can establish vertiport locations, subject to federal safety standards and FAA approval. Public vertiports and charging stations must be open to public bidding without preference to existing operators.
